Lea Bridge to Bognor Regis by train

Planning a train journey from Lea Bridge to Bognor Regis? The trip usually takes about 3hrs 14 mins, covering approximately 60 miles (97 kilometres). With roughly 35 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£42.00,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ities at Lea Bridge

Despite the lack of a ticket office, Lea Bridge is equipped with user-friendly ticket machines from which you can effortlessly collect pre-purchased tickets. These machines are conveniently located at the bottom of the stairs leading to Platform 1, providing easy access to all travelers, including those with mobility issues. Furthermore, the presence of smartcard validators caters to modern commuting needs, even though smartcards aren't issued at this station.

Help points and departure screens ensure that assistance and information are always at hand—proving quite advantageous for any last-minute travel plans. Security is uncompromised with CCTV coverage yet, it's slightly disappointing that the station lacks some amenities like waiting rooms, seating areas, and refreshment facilities. Nonetheless, step-free access to platforms and staff-trained to assist passengers with disabilities, maintain a high level of accessibility.

Facilities and Amenities at Bognor Regis Station

Bognor Regis Station offers a range of amenities to ensure a comfortable start or finish to your travels. The ticket office operates from 06:00 to 19:50 from Monday to Saturday, and from 08:10 to 19:45 on Sundays, helping you easily purchase tickets for your journey. Automatic ticket machines are also available, and they support concessions like the Disabled Persons Railcard, ensuring no one gets left behind.

While lounging at the station, you can take advantage of heated waiting rooms open 24/7, although there are no first-class lounges. The station’s accessibility is top-tier, with step-free access to all platforms and ramps available to assist boarding for guests with limited mobility. Wi-Fi isn't available, so make sure to download any necessary information before you arrive. Unfortunately, the station does not offer luggage storage or baby changing facilities, but there are toilets available for brief stops.

Onward Travel Options

Need to reach a destination that's not directly accessible by train from Bognor Regis? Fear not. The station connects you to various transport options. A taxi rank can be found right at the front of the station, ensuring a quick and easy exit. Planning to catch a bus? Detailed information on local bus services is available in the station's Onward Travel Information Map, making it easy to plan your onward journey.
